I have just replaced the standard fan on my cpu for a bigger one and now on start up I get a cpu fan error press f1 to resume , why when it is running ok. The only thing I have noticed is that the power plug on the new one is a 3 pin as the old one was a 4 pin . Are there different power pins on the mainboard to plug into.

4 pin to allow for speed control
1 grd black
2 yellow 12v
3 green sensor
4 blue control
What colour cables does yours have?

Forgot to ask what sort of cpu as AMD is different
1 grd black
2 red 12v
3 yellow sensor
4 blue control

Ok so is the yellow sensor cable fitted?
You may have to co into the BIOS to disable fan speed sensing / control
